/**
*  corner() takes a single string argument:  $('#myDiv').corner("effect corners width")
*
*  effect:  name of the effect to apply, such as round, bevel, notch, bite, etc (default is round). 
*  corners: one or more of: top, bottom, tr, tl, br, or bl. 
*           by default, all four corners are adorned. 
*  width:   width of the effect; in the case of rounded corners this is the radius. 
*           specify this value using the px suffix such as 10px (and yes, it must be pixels).
*
* @author Dave Methvin (http://methvin.com/jquery/jq-corner.html)
* @author Mike Alsup   (http://jquery.malsup.com/corner/)
*/
